There is no cut off, it has to be given when is needed. E.g. if you have a newborn presenting with gonococcal ophthalmia, a dose of IM or IV ceftriaxone must be given immediately. Also you can use for neonatal sepsis if cefotaxime is not available or if the neonate can not tolerate gentamicin (renal impairment), and other indications, just monitor for jaundice in neonates and other side effects as any other antibiotics.
